The Green Bay Packers take on the Chicago Bears in Week 1 of the NFL season. Here’s five questions we’ll need answered on opening weekend.

The NFL season is finally here with the Green Bay Packers first regular season game just days away. They take on the Chicago Bears at Lambeau Field to kick off the Packers’ centennial season. It doesn’t get any more historic than this rivalry.

The Packers lead the all-time series 96-94-6 with the teams splitting games in the postseason. They first met back on Nov. 27, 1921 which resulted in a 20-0 Bears’ victory. Currently, Green Bay has won the last four games including their most recent contest on Nov. 12, 2017.
